  ENGLISH <<\nEmbark on a journey to Space and into the heart of the Arctic
  - under extreme conditions.\nJulia Schmale\, professor at the Extreme Env
 ironment Research Laboratory at EPFL\, will share her experience of the Ar
 ctic drift experiment MOSAiC. Chloé Carrière\, president of the associat
 ion Space@yourService\, will speak about the Asclepios project: a simulati
 ng mission on another celestial body.\nJulia Schmale: \nSpecialist in atm
 ospheric sciences\, Julia Schmale is a professor at the Extreme Environmen
 t Research Laboratory at EPFL. From January till June 2020\, she participa
 ted in the Arctic drift experiment MOSAiC. She is active in international 
 and interdisciplinary research efforts in the Arctic as a representative o
 f Switzerland.\nChloé Carrière:\nChloé Carrière is a physics student a
 t EPFL and president of the association Space@yourService\, whose mission 
 is to make space science more accessible. She manages space-related events
  such as Astronomy on Tap Lausanne and the Asclepios mission which simulat
 es a mission on another celestial body for educational and research purpos
 es. \nPlease register here.\nYou will then receive by e-mail the ZOOM lin
